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your home and assess the damage, identifying the source of the water and the extent of the damage. We’ll then develop a customized plan to remove the water, dry the area, and restore your home to its original condition.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our.

Step 2: Water Removal

Our team will use state-of-the-art equipment to remove the water from your home. This may involve using wet vacuums, pumps, and other specialized tools to extract the water. We’ll also use moisture-detecting equipment to ensure that all areas are dry and free of moisture.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the area. This may involve using industrial-grade fans, dehumidifiers, and other equipment to speed up the drying process. We’ll also use moisture-detecting equipment to ensure that all areas are dry and free of moisture.

Step 4: Restoration and Repair

Once the area is dry, our team will begin the restoration and repair process. This may involve replacing drywall, flooring, and other damaged materials. We’ll also work with you to ensure that any necessary repairs are made to prevent future dam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Once the restoration and repair work is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the area is safe and dry. We’ll also clean up any remaining debris and equipment, leaving your home looking like new.

Bedroom Water Removal Cost in Centereach, NY

The cost of bedroom water removal in Centereach, NY,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a standard bedroom water removal service. But, this cost can increase if the damage is extensive or if specialized equipment is required. We’ll provide you with a detailed estimate and explanation of the costs involved, so you can make an informed decision about your home’s restoration.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Drying $500 – $1,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ment required
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$3,000 Extensiveness of damage, materials required, labor costs
Dehumidification and Moisture Control $200 – $500 Size of affected area, equipment required, duration of service
Disinfection and Sanitizing $100 – $300 Severity of damage, size of affected area, equipment required
Inspection and Testing $50 – $200 Frequency of testing, equipment required, complexity of inspection
